Chris’s Doomben Best Bets Posted on July 8, 2016July 11, 2016 | Posted by Chris Nelson Chris Nelson’s Preview RACE 1 No.10 Persistent Shadow Gympie trained filly who raced consistently in North/Central Queensland before being brought to town last time out and making good late ground at Eagle Farm over 1200m. Like her rising to the 1350m tomorrow and she’s bound to gain the right run for Brad Pengelly off the good draw. Rates a terrific each-way chance. RACE 2 No.8 Divine Service This looks a two horse race with the speedy types Upstart Pride and Divine Service very likely to control proceedings from the outset. Divine Service draws inside his main rival and at the weights has a whopping 6.5kg advantage which will prove all important when the chips are down in the straight. That should be enough to see him get home. RACE 7 No.3 Brettan Deagon trained galloper who chased home the flying Flamboyer at Eagle Farm a fortnight back in a fast run race. Flamboyer has since come out and won again landing the Listed Glasshouse at the Sunshine Coast last Saturday in impressive style. Fitter for that outing he’ll gain a cosy run behind the speed tomorrow and prove hard to hold out over the concluding stages.
